#a80098 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a80098 is composed of 65.9% red, 0%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 9.5%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 305.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 32.9%. #a80098 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#510031.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

● #a80098 color description : Dark magenta.
#a80098 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a80098 has RGB values of R:168, G:0,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.1,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 11010200.

Shades and Tints of #a80098
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b000a is the darkest color, while #fff6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a80098
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a4e59 is the less saturated color, while #a80098 is the most saturated one.
